Hand Motif
by Jen Hayes
I wrote this pattern to remember and celebrate those with rare diseases. Created as a flat motif, this pattern can be used in a variety of ways! I would love to see how you decide to use it!
Materials
Worsted Weight Yarn in brand and color of choice
In this pattern I used: Caron Simply Soft in Watermelon, Pistachio, and Blue Mint
Size G/4.0mm hook (or preferred hook size)
Stitch Marker(s)
Scissors
Tapestry needle
Stitches Used:
ch – Chain
Hdc – half double crochet
hdc2tog – half double crochet 2 stitches together (decrease)
Hdcinc – half double crochet increase
sl st – Slip stitch
FO – Fasten Off
